An Aerial Glimpse of Fiji’s Mamanuca Islands

Nadi: 25 minutes Mamanuca Island Tour - An Aerial Glimpse of Fiji’s Mamanuca Islands

This helicopter tour is a fantastic way to get a panoramic perspective of the Mamanuca archipelago—an area affectionately called the Playground of the Pacific. Located just off the west coast of Viti Levu, the islands are famous for their white sandy beaches, swaying palms, and coral reefs, which you’ll see clearly from above.

What makes this trip special is its ability to quickly cover a lot of ground—at least in the air. You’ll glide over lush islands, observe the turquoise waters surrounding them, and get a sense of the scale of this tropical paradise. It’s particularly impressive if you appreciate geography and natural scenery, as the flight offers views of Mount Evans Range foothills and other landmarks.

Highlights: Surf, Resorts, and History

Nadi: 25 minutes Mamanuca Island Tour - Highlights: Surf, Resorts, and History

The tour isn’t just about pretty pictures. It’s a curated view of some of the most famous surf breaks in the world. You’ll fly over Cloudbreak, a legendary wave that’s considered one of the top ten in the world, and others like Wilkes Passage, Restaurant, Tavy Rights, and Namotu Lefts. If you’re a surfing fan, these names alone signal you’re in surf-lovers’ territory, and seeing them from above emphasizes their scale and power.

Another highlight is the view of Fiji’s first overwater bungalow resort, the Likuliku Lagoon Resort, which exemplifies the island’s luxury accommodation. From the air, the resort’s unique structure stands out, offering a glimpse of Fiji’s high-end, exclusive appeal.

You will also catch a quick look at Heart Island and the Gun Tower on Malolo Island, a relic from World War II. While brief, these historical insights add an extra layer of interest for those curious about Fiji’s past.

Practical Details and Planning Tips

Nadi: 25 minutes Mamanuca Island Tour - Practical Details and Planning Tips

The tour is well-suited for travelers who are not easily scared of heights and who are comfortable with helicopter rides. The maximum passenger weight per seat is 136 kg, and it’s not recommended for those with mobility issues or claustrophobia.

What to bring? Pack comfortable clothes and shoes, a camera for snapping aerial photos, passport or ID, and water. It’s best to avoid heavy accessories or anything that might block your view.

Since the experience is weather-dependent, it can be rescheduled or canceled if conditions aren’t safe—so having flexible plans is wise. Also, note that there’s a merchant fee of 3.5% on credit cards, though debit cards are fee-free.
